tcp/ip模型:包括
tcp/ip模型:包括
OSI参考模型与TPC/IP参考模型都采用了层次结构,但OSI采用的是七层模型
OSI 和tcp/ip
1.区别
都采用了层次结构
osi 七层结构
tcp/ip是四层
传输层功能基本类似
tcp/ip传输层是建立在互联层基础之上,互联层提供无连接的服务,面向连接的功能完全在TCP协议中实现,UDP(user datagram protocol)提供无连接服务;
osi传输层建立在网络层之上,既提供连接的服务也提供无连接的服务,传输层只提供面向连接的服务
tcp/ip中没有会话层和表示层。
2.osi与tcp/ip优缺点
osi抽象能力高,适合于描述各种网络,由于定义时考虑不足,造成协议与模型脱节;
tcp/ip与各个协议吻合的很好,不适合于描述其他非tcp/ip网络
osi概念划分清晰,详细的定义了服务、接口和协议关系,普遍适应性好
缺点是过于繁杂,难于实现,效率低
tcp/ip在接口、服务和协议的区别不清楚,功能描述和细节混合,因此对采取新技术设计网络的指导意义不大,
tcp/ip网络接口层并不是真正的层,在数据链路层和物理层的划分上基本是空白
osi缺点是层次过多,增加了复杂性
3.协议栈
任务分解成子任务,通过进程中协议完成子任务
特定协议完成osi中特定的子任务
当这些协议组织起来完成一个完整任务时,协议的集合就是一个协议栈,能实现整个通信过程
4.协议与绑定
不同协议栈可以完成网络功能,计算机上安装不同网卡,一个计算机可以同时安装多个网卡,可以使用多个协议栈
绑定过程是在协议栈和网卡驱动之间建立关联,多个协议可以绑定同一个网卡,一台多网卡计算机可以将一个协议绑定到两个以上的网卡
当服务器需要同时与局域网和Internet主干网连接时,需要在服务器同时安装至少两块网卡,分别于主干网和局域网连接
netBEUI
NETbios extended user interface
network basic input/output system
NW LINK
APPLE TALK
协议分类
TCP/IP协议
参考模型对比,OSI和TCP/IP
讲的真好,谢谢老师!
OSI采用了7层模型,TCO/IP是四层结构(实际上是3层结构)